在编程比赛中,使用的道具主要包括以下几种:
电脑
编程比赛的基本工具,用于编写、调试和运行代码。选手可以使用个人电脑、笔记本电脑或其他移动设备。
编程软件
选手需要使用各种编程软件来进行编码。常见的编程软件包括IDE(集成开发环境)和文本编辑器。IDE通常提供编码和调试功能,如代码补全、调试器等。常见的IDE有Visual Studio、Eclipse、PyCharm等。
代码库
在编程比赛中,选手可以使用现有的代码库来加速开发过程。代码库中包含了各种已编写好的代码,选手可以直接调用并进行修改。
纸笔
尽管大部分的编程比赛是在电脑上进行的,但在某些情况下,选手可能需要使用纸笔来进行草图、算法设计和逻辑推理。
硬件设备
某些编程比赛可能需要与硬件设备进行互动,如机器人编程比赛。在这种情况下,选手会使用一些特殊的硬件设备,如传感器、执行器等。
云服务
云服务提供了一种便捷的方式来进行编程比赛。选手可以使用云服务来存储和共享代码,以及进行虚拟环境和服务器的配置。
算法书籍和教程
除了具体的教具外,选手还需要阅读和学习相关的算法书籍和教程来提升编程能力和解题技巧。
其他辅助工具
根据比赛的具体要求,选手可能还需要使用其他辅助工具,如版本控制系统(如Git)、调试工具、性能分析工具等。
建议
熟悉常用编程软件和工具:选手应提前熟悉并掌握比赛要求的编程语言和相关工具,以提高编程效率。
善于利用资源:除了比赛提供的资源外,还可以利用互联网上的编程论坛、博客、教学视频等资源来学习和思考解决问题的方法。
准备充分:在比赛前,应确保所有必要的教具和资源都已准备齐全,并提前进行测试,以确保在比赛中能够顺利进行。